About Cyngn
Based in Mountain View, CA, Cyngn is a publicly-traded autonomous technology company. We deploy self-driving industrial vehicles — specifically autonomous tuggers — to factories, warehouses, and other facilities throughout North America. About This Role
As Cyngn scales its production deployments of Autonomous Mobile Robots (AMRs), we are seeking a highly capable Field Services Engineer to join our growing team. This role is essential to the success of our customer deployment production operations and requires both technical skill and field service acumen. Based in Mountain View, CA, this role involves frequent travel to customer sites to support, maintain, and troubleshoot our deployed robotic systems. This position bridges hands-on hardware interaction, field maintenance, software updates, and close collaboration with engineering and operations teams. You will be a key player in keeping our production systems running smoothly in real-world customer environments.
Responsibilities
- Travel to customer locations to perform installation, repair, upgrades, and calibration of production robotic systems.
- Conduct field-based diagnostics, perform root cause analysis, and execute corrective actions to maintain uptime.
- Collaborate with Engineering Services and Engineering teams to deploy software updates, log issues, and provide feedback from the field.
- Replace and configure hardware components, sensors, and subsystems as needed.
- Execute configuration and parameter changes, including network and system settings on deployed robots.
- Interface directly with customer teams to provide status updates, answer technical questions, and ensure customer satisfaction.
- Maintain logs of service activity, diagnostics data, and configuration changes in a structured and reliable format.
- Support initial site bring-up and commissioning efforts for new deployments.
- Assist with documentation development and service procedure refinement.
- Support weekend and after-hours troubleshooting on an on-call rotation basis.
Qualifications
- 2+ years in a technical field service, robotics, or hardware support role.
- Ability and willingness to travel regularly (30–50% anticipated).
- Proficiency with Linux terminal, remote troubleshooting, and basic shell scripting.
- Strong hands-on skills with mechanical/electrical components and system-level debugging.
- Excellent communication and customer service skills.
- Ability to lift up to 80 lbs and work in industrial or warehouse environments.
- Capable of interpreting schematics, wiring diagrams, and engineering documentation.

Does Cyngn sponsor H-1B visas?
Yes, Cyngn sponsors H-1B visas. The company has an established track record of filing H-1B petitions, primarily for technical roles in software engineering and autonomous systems. If you're targeting an H-1B with Cyngn, confirm sponsorship intent during the offer stage and ask whether they use outside immigration counsel to manage the petition process.
Which visa types does Cyngn sponsor?
Cyngn sponsors H-1B and TN visas for temporary work authorization, and supports Green Card sponsorship through the EB-2 and EB-3 employment-based immigrant visa categories. The company also hires candidates on F-1 OPT and F-1 CPT, making it accessible to international students currently studying or recently graduated in the United States.
What types of roles at Cyngn are most likely to receive visa sponsorship?
Sponsorship at Cyngn is concentrated in technical disciplines that support its autonomous vehicle platform. Roles in software engineering, robotics, machine learning, computer vision, and systems integration are the strongest candidates. Given the company's focus on industrial autonomy, candidates with relevant specializations in these areas are most likely to receive an offer that includes immigration support.

How do I approach the visa sponsorship conversation with Cyngn during hiring?
Raise the sponsorship question after you've received a verbal indication of interest but before a written offer is finalized. Ask specifically which visa type they plan to sponsor, whether they work with an immigration attorney, and what the expected timeline looks like. For H-1B candidates, confirming the April lottery registration window is especially important if your current work authorization is expiring soon.
